TopCoder

FHVirus
想像不出自己 AC 的題目是實作不出來的!

User's AC Ratio

93.8% (270/288)

Submission's AC Ratio

44.0% (425/966)

Tags

Description

給你長度為 $N$ 的一個正整數序列,請你求出最長嚴格遞增子序列的長度。
所謂嚴格遞增子序列,是指去掉序列中的某些數字之後,剩下的子序列是嚴格遞增的。

Input Format

第一列有一個正整數 $N$($1 \le N \le 10 ^ 5$)
第二列有 $N$ 個以空白隔開的正整數。

Output Format

輸出 LIS 的長度。

Sample Input 1

10
1 3 2 4 6 5 7 8 10 9

Sample Output 1

7

Hints

※額外的測試中:
  總共至少有 30% 的測試資料 $N \le 10$
  總共至少有 60% 的測試資料 $N \le 1000$

Problem Source

原TIOJ1175 / TIOJ Contest #1020。Problem Setter:Tmt。
2020.03.10 Update: Added $\LaTeX$ by FHVirus

Subtasks

No. Testdata Range Score
1 0 9
2 1 9
3 2 9
4 3 9
5 4 9
6 5 9
7 6 9
8 7 9
9 8 9
10 9 9
11 10 10

Testdata and Limits

No. Time Limit (ms) Memory Limit (VSS, KiB) Output Limit (KiB) Subtasks
0 1000 65536 262144 1
1 1000 65536 262144 2
2 1000 65536 262144 3
3 1000 65536 262144 4
4 1000 65536 262144 5
5 1000 65536 262144 6
6 1000 65536 262144 7
7 1000 65536 262144 8
8 1000 65536 262144 9
9 1000 65536 262144 10
10 1000 65536 262144 11